CVE-2008-3214Date: (C)2008-07-18   (M)2023-12-22


dnsmasq 2.25 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(daemon crash) by (1) renewing a nonexistent lease or (2) sending a DHCPREQUEST for an IP address that is not in the same network, related to the DHCP NAK response from the daemon.

CVSS Score and Metrics +CVSS Score and Metrics -

CVSS V2 Severity:
CVSS Score : 7.8
Exploit Score: 10.0
Impact Score: 6.9
 
CVSS V2 Metrics:
Access Vector: NETWORK
Access Complexity: LOW
Authentication: NONE
Confidentiality: NONE
Integrity: NONE
Availability: COMPLETE
